Nomad Tax Gate features and specs

  • Specialized for Digital Nomads
    Nomad Tax Gate focuses specifically on the tax needs of digital nomads, remote workers, and location-independent professionals, offering tailored expertise that general tax firms may lack.
  • International Tax Expertise
    The service is designed to handle the complexities of multi-jurisdictional tax situations, helping clients navigate tax obligations across different countries and residency statuses.
  • Remote-First Service Model
    As an online-based service, Nomad Tax Gate operates remotely, making it convenient for clients who are constantly traveling or living abroad without needing in-person meetings.
  • Niche Knowledge of Nomad Tax Strategies
    The firm understands common tax optimization strategies relevant to digital nomads, such as foreign earned income exclusions, tax treaties, and establishing tax residency in favorable jurisdictions.
  • Targeted Audience Understanding
    By focusing on a specific lifestyle demographic, the team is likely more empathetic and knowledgeable about the unique financial challenges nomads face, such as fluctuating income sources and multiple currencies.

Possible disadvantages of Nomad Tax Gate

  • Limited Public Reviews
    As a relatively niche service, Nomad Tax Gate may have fewer publicly available client reviews and testimonials compared to larger, more established tax firms, making it harder to gauge reliability.
  • Potentially Higher Costs
    Specialized tax services for international and nomad-specific situations can be more expensive than standard tax preparation services, which may not suit budget-conscious freelancers.
  • Narrow Service Scope
    The firm's focus on digital nomads means it may not be the best fit for individuals with more traditional or domestic-only tax situations, limiting its versatility.
  • Limited Track Record Visibility
    It can be difficult to verify the firm's credentials, success stories, and long-term track record compared to well-known international tax advisory firms with decades of history.
  • Dependence on Online Communication
    While the remote model is convenient, some clients may find the lack of face-to-face interaction a drawback, especially when dealing with complex or sensitive financial matters that benefit from in-person consultations.
